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

What it actually says
Run the architecture-fit-check skill on $ARGUMENTS (default: the subsystem touched by the current change, or the design under discussion).
Produce the five-question audit, a fit verdict (fits / mismatch / needs-observability), and — if mismatched — the fitting primitive from the decision matrix plus the cheapest falsifiable spike to prove the substrate before committing.
